課程
/運維&測試
/Linux
/Linux網絡管理
接收端接收到以后判斷以太幀頭應該就可以準確判斷是不是傳給自己的了,接下去ip層的判斷應該走不走都問題不大吧?
2017-02-27
源自:Linux網絡管理 1-4
正在回答
以太幀是二層協議的概念,而路由功能指的是第三層(網絡層),通信過程中由第三層協議封裝的發起請求的ip地址和請求目標的ip地址是不變的。如果這兩個ip連接在同一個交換機上,或者說具有相同的網關地址,那么交換機或者網橋(現在幾乎不用了)就可以在二層協議下(通過Mac幀找到主機)完成兩臺計算機之間數據的通信。但是如果兩個ip地址屬于不同的網段,這時候僅僅靠以太幀頭是不夠用的,發送端的數據發送到路由器(路由器作為接收端),路由器在第三層(你說的ip層)協議下將目標ip地址通過路由表找到最合適的路徑,將數據發送到對應的路由器或主機,這個過程路由器需要重新封裝以太幀頭,將以太幀頭的mac地址指向將要發送到的那個路由器或者主機,依次傳下去
舉報
為你帶來Linux網絡環境搭建,介紹遠程登錄工具的使用
5 回答收藏課程怎么做
1 回答ping域名之后,0接收,包全部丟失怎么回事??
1 回答遠程連接提示連接超時
3 回答telnet 80端口連接失敗
2 回答我本機是通過天翼客戶端連接上網的,自動獲取ip..然后我linux連接不上網
Copyright ? 2025 imooc.com All Rights Reserved | 京ICP備12003892號-11 京公網安備11010802030151號
購課補貼聯系客服咨詢優惠詳情
慕課網APP您的移動學習伙伴
掃描二維碼關注慕課網微信公眾號
2017-02-27
以太幀是二層協議的概念,而路由功能指的是第三層(網絡層),通信過程中由第三層協議封裝的發起請求的ip地址和請求目標的ip地址是不變的。如果這兩個ip連接在同一個交換機上,或者說具有相同的網關地址,那么交換機或者網橋(現在幾乎不用了)就可以在二層協議下(通過Mac幀找到主機)完成兩臺計算機之間數據的通信。但是如果兩個ip地址屬于不同的網段,這時候僅僅靠以太幀頭是不夠用的,發送端的數據發送到路由器(路由器作為接收端),路由器在第三層(你說的ip層)協議下將目標ip地址通過路由表找到最合適的路徑,將數據發送到對應的路由器或主機,這個過程路由器需要重新封裝以太幀頭,將以太幀頭的mac地址指向將要發送到的那個路由器或者主機,依次傳下去